Didn't I read that you can take a boat from MGM to Epcot? It sure would be handy if we could do that.
 
Yes, but it takes at least 30 minutes.....
stops at S/D, Yacht Club, and Boardwalk
before heading over to Epcot. You may want to walk directly or take boat to S/D
and walk via the Boardwalk.
 
yes you can.
however it stops at Swan/Dolphin, Yacht/Beach, Boardwalk, THEN Epcot.

My advice? if you are able bodied, and want to get there quick, get off at the Yacht/Beach club stop, and walk to EPCOT...you'll beat the boat.

Total trip - by boat - from MGM to Epcot is around 24 minutes I think. You can cut this in half by walking from Yacht/Beach.
 
It does take about a half an hour, but it's a nice, relaxing break! I love just sitting for 30 minutes and taking in all the sights.
 

I would suggest getting off the boat at the first stop, the Swan/Dolphin. The walk from MGM to Swan/Dolphin is relatively boring and the longest part of the walk to Epcot. From the Swan, you can walk to Epcot via the Boardwalk. It's about a 10 minute walk and fun walking across the Boardwalk.

We took the boat from MGM to Epcot this summer, just before Frances hit. We'd parked at MGM since we started the day there. The boat was really relaxing and we really enjoyed it. When we left Epcot after Illuminations that night to go back on the boat it only was scheduled to return as far as the Swan/Dolphin stop. When the captain heard that we'd parked at MGM he decided to take us all the way back to MGM so we didn't have to walk that last leg. It was a magical way to end our day, that's for sure.

The captain said that since MGM closed so much earlier in the evening than Epcot they stop running that part of the route about an hour after MGM closes.
